Motorists convicted of various offences
MOTORING offences drew fines as Judge Brian O’Shea imposed convictions at his first District Court sitting of the new year held in Gorey.
Tony Lyons of 19 Bracken Hill, Blackwater, entered a plea of guilty through solicitor Peter Crean to being on the road at Kilmuckridge on May 1 last without an up-to-date tax disc fine €120.
Fiach James Stafford (21) from Cullentragh, Kiltealy, was summonsed as a learner permit holder on the road at the wheel of a Volkswagen Golf without a qualified driver at Templeshannon in Enniscorthy early on the morning of April 13 last – fine €100.
Ryan Kirwan (18) from Dun Fiach, Monart East, Enniscorthy, was stopped by the garda traffic corps at Milehouse Road on April 18 last. A learner permit holder, he had no qualified driver with him in a Vauxhall Insignia hatchback fine €180.
Manuel Vasile Neagu (32) of 27 Court Street, Enniscorthy, was found to have no valid motor tax disc on the Audi A6 saloon he was driving at Friary Place in Enniscorthy on April 18 last year fine €160.
Andy Connors (28) from The Mobile, Templescoby, Enniscorthy, had a front tyre in very poor condition when his blue Mercedes van was inspected by a garda at Cherryorchard on April 18 last fine €120.
John Daly (37) from Coolamaine, Oylegate, was seen driving at Templeshannon in Enniscorthy while holding a phone on May 1 last fine €150.
Simon Sullivan (32) of 12 Hazelwood, Gorey, was summonsed as the person nominated by the registered owner of a vehicle detected speeding at Motabower on the evening of May 20 last at 99 km/h where the 80 km/h limit is in force fine €140.
